Zucchini Fritters

Ingredients
  • 3 medium zucchini, grated
  • ½ c. onion, grated
  • 1 egg, beaten
  • ¼ c. all-purpose flour
  • ¼ c. plain cornmeal
  • sal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
  • Canola oil, for frying
  • Freshly grated Parmesan cheese
Instructions
  1. Grate zucchini into a medium size bowl. Toss with a pinch of salt and place in a mesh strainer. Place the strainer over the bowl and let stand for about 15 minutes. Remove strainer and reserve the water in bowl. Place zucchini in a mixing bowl and add the grated onion. Add egg, salt and pepper and mix. Sprinkle the flour and cornmeal over the zucchini and mix together. Let stand at room temperature for about 10 minutes.
  2. In the meantime, heat canola oil over medium-high heat to 350°F.
  3. Stir zucchini mixture, the consistency should be a little thicker than pancake batter. If it seems too thick you can add a little bit of the reserved water.
  4. Drop by heaping spoonfuls into the hot oil cooking 2 to 3 minutes, until golden brown, then flip and cook the other side until golden. Remove to a paper towel lined plate to drain. Immediately sprinkle with salt and grate fresh Parmesan cheese over the top. Serve immediately.
